Through OPEN UK, the APPG on Obesity and APPG on a Fit and Healthy Childhood, I contribute research evidence and support the design, delivery and evaluation of activities to influence and support policy-related actions related to obesity and wider public health.

I continue to work with PHE on obesity-related actions and policy, and am currently working with PHE on research examining the impact of the coronavirus (COVID-19) pandemic on people living with obesity and weight management service provision which has provided evidence for a rapid evidence report. I am a regular international and national speaker at conferences, have spoken frequently in UK parliament and appeared regularly in the media to discuss public health and obesity policies, as well as my research and advocacy work.

During the COVID-19 pandemic, I was appointed as a member of the Leeds City Region COVID-19 outbreak board and the Emotional Wellbeing in the Community board for Suffolk County.
